Description: AdvanceCOMP is an open-source compression utility that supports gzip, bzip2, and 7z formats. It provides advanced compression algorithms and options for optimizing compression.

Description: Caesium is a free, open source image compression software for Windows, Mac and Linux. It allows lossless compression of PNG and JPEG files with compression ratios up to 83% smaller than the originals.
